MySQL,掌上Linux数据库
2023-12-16 01:50:17
在 Linux 上开启轻松的 MySQL 安装之旅
认识 MySQL:数据库界的明星
MySQL,一款家喻户晓的开源关系型数据库管理系统,在 IT 领域有着举足轻重的地位。无论你是初入门的菜鸟还是经验丰富的技术大咖,它都会是你工具箱中不可或缺的一员。
开启 MySQL 安装之旅
准备好踏上 Linux 系统中 MySQL 的安装之旅了吗?让我们一步步进行:
第一步:系统准备
确保你的 Linux 系统已经安装了 Essentials 组件,包括 GCC、make、glibc 和 ncurses。它们就像 MySQL 的好朋友,缺一不可。
第二步:下载 MySQL
前往 MySQL 官方网站,下载与你的系统版本相匹配的 MySQL 版本。现在,你已经拥有了安装包,接下来让我们释放它的力量。
第三步:解压 MySQL
将下载的压缩包解压到你的目标安装目录中。这是一个激动人心的时刻,你的 MySQL 之家即将诞生。
第四步:为系统奠基
1. 创建 MySQL 用户: 专门为 MySQL 运行创建一个用户,并赋予它必要的权限。它就像 MySQL 的专属管家,拥有管理和控制权。
2. 初始化 MySQL: 运行一个脚本来初始化 MySQL,为后续的安装和配置铺平道路。就像为你的汽车做保养,这是让 MySQL 顺利运行的重要一步。
3. 安装 MySQL: 根据你选择的安装方式,作为 root 用户运行相应的安装命令。想象一下,你现在正在亲手打造 MySQL 的家园。
第五步:调整 MySQL 设置
1. 调整 MySQL 配置文件: 修改 MySQL 的配置文件以满足你的需求,就像为你的房子装修一样。你可以调整数据库端口、数据目录等。
2. 启动 MySQL 服务: 是时候让 MySQL 服务启动了,就像打开你的房子的大门。这样你才能与数据库进行交互。
3. 创建数据库: 连接到 MySQL 服务器,创建你需要的数据库。它们就像你的房间,每个房间都有自己的用途。
4. 导入数据: 将你的数据导入到新创建的数据库中,就像搬进你的新家。现在,你的数据有了安身之所。
第六步:胜利在望
1. 测试数据库: 执行一些简单的查询来检查数据库是否运行良好。就像医生为病人做体检,确保一切正常。
2. 备份数据库: 为你的数据库进行备份,就像给自己买一份保险。以防万一发生意外,你的数据始终安全无虞。
3. 安全配置: 加强 MySQL 的安全性,就像在你的房子周围安装警报器。防止未经授权的访问和数据泄露。
4. 探索 MySQL: 继续学习 MySQL 的更多知识,就像探索你新家的每个角落。充分挖掘它的强大功能。
结论:掌控数据库世界
恭喜你,你现在已经成功地安装了 MySQL。随着你对它的深入了解,你将发现它是一款让你掌控数据库世界的强大工具。
常见问题解答
- 如何检查 MySQL 是否正在运行?
运行 systemctl status mysql
命令来查看 MySQL 服务的状态。
- 如何创建新的 MySQL 数据库?
连接到 MySQL 服务器,然后运行 CREATE DATABASE database_name;
命令。
- 如何导入数据到 MySQL 数据库?
使用 LOAD DATA INFILE 'file_name.csv' INTO TABLE table_name
命令从 CSV 文件中导入数据。
- 如何备份 MySQL 数据库?
使用 mysqldump database_name > backup.sql
命令将数据库备份到 SQL 文件中。
- 如何加强 MySQL 的安全性?
使用 GRANT
和 REVOKE
命令管理用户权限,并启用 SSL 加密以保护数据传输。